Position Purpose: At The Home Depot, we help doers get more done.   O ur Learning Design & Development team   creates   simple, relevant, and effective learning experiences   for   our orange-blooded associates.   We have   a strong team   of   I nstructional   D esigners who are focused on   building   associate   capability and driving business performance , and   we’re   looking to add to the team.    That’s   where you come in!   Our Instructional Designers   appl y   design   expertise , learning science, emerging technologies, and AI-enabled tools to create engaging learning experiences across multiple modalities. Working closely with business partners and subject matter experts, the Instructional Designer transforms performance needs into effective learning solutions while delivering high-quality project execution from analysis through implementation.   This role   continuously explores   new technologies , design approaches, and AI-enabled workflows to improve efficiency , learner engagement,   and learning outcomes .   When you join The Home Depot, you join a team that takes care of our people.   The Instructional Designer take s   care of our   associates   by   ensur ing   they are   competent and confident   to   achieve   business results .    Interested ?   Here’s   what   we’re   looking for:   You are   passionate about development   and   create   learning solutions from a “learner-back” perspective by   applying instructional design   and   adult learning principles .       You have experience with   all phases of the course creation lifecycle , including analysis, design, and development.   You have   a track record   of using   innovative approaches   and   leveraging AI   in both your workflow and your designs .    You have experience   working   with in   Agile Learning Development   or the   Successive Approximation Model (SAM)   environments.     You are   self-driven ,   collaborative,   resourceful, and excellent at project management.    You are a trusted consultant and partner   with   strong   communication   skills .   Y ou’re   able to   flex your   communicat ion across   various   levels, both in person and virtually .     Is this you?   If so, we want to talk to you!    Major Tasks, Responsibilities,   and Key Accountabilities   50%   -   Design and develop   learning   solutions, including eLearning, instructor-led training,   distance   learning, blended learning, etc.    20% - Collaborate with   Learning Strategy Senior Managers and   subject matter experts during the analysis phase and throughout the project.      10% - Work with standard development tools and software (Articulate Storyline / Rise,   PowerPoint, etc.).     10% - Communicate with project team members and effectively manage projects.      10% - Work on creative and innovative ways to develop   associates .
